4-Bromo-2-fluoropyridine

CAS 128071-98-7C5H3BrFNChemical Synthesis

4-Bromo-2-fluoropyridine (CAS: 128071-98-7) is a halogenated heterocyclic compound with the molecular formula C5H3BrFN and a molecular weight of 175.99 g/mol. As a fluorinated pyridine derivative, it serves as a versatile building block in organic synthesis. Its primary applications lie in the development of novel pharmaceuticals and agrochemicals, leveraging the unique reactivity conferred by the bromine and fluorine substituents.

01 /Applications

Pharmaceutical Intermediate

Utilised in the synthesis of active pharmaceutical ingredients (APIs) and drug discovery programs. The pyridine core and halogen substituents allow for diverse functionalisation strategies in medicinal chemistry.

Agrochemical Development

Serves as a key intermediate in the creation of new pesticides, herbicides, and fungicides. The presence of fluorine can enhance the efficacy and metabolic stability of agrochemical compounds.

Organic Synthesis Building Block

A valuable reagent for introducing the 2-fluoropyridinyl moiety into complex organic molecules. Its reactivity profile makes it suitable for cross-coupling reactions and other transformations.

Material Science Research

Explored for potential use in the development of advanced materials, where its electronic and structural properties might be beneficial.

02 /Properties
Molecular weight175.99
Empirical formulaC5H3BrFN
Assay97%
Density1.713 g/mL at 25 °C
Refractive indexn20/D 1.531
03 /Safety & handling
GHS hazard pictogram: Corrosive (GHS05)
Corrosive
GHS hazard pictogram: Harmful / irritant (GHS07)
Harmful / irritant
Danger

Hazard statements

  • H302Harmful if swallowed
  • H315Causes skin irritation
  • H318Causes serious eye damage
  • H335May cause respiratory irritation

Precautionary statements

  • P261Avoid breathing dust, fume, gas or vapours
  • P280Wear protective gloves, clothing and eye/face protection
  • P305IF IN EYES
Flash point71 °C / 159.8 °F
Transport (UN / ADR)NA 1993 / PGIII
Water hazard class (WGK, DE)3
Hazard codes (EU)Xn
Risk statements (R)22-37/38-41
Safety statements (S)26-39

Hazard information is provided for guidance. Always consult the product Safety Data Sheet (SDS), available on request, before handling.
